On Fri, Oct 4, 2013 at 7:06 PM, Zhihao Yuan <zy@miator.net> wrote:

> On Fri, Oct 4, 2013 at 9:33 PM, Richard Smith <richard@metafoo.co.uk>
> wrote:
> >   /*template<typename Mutex> std::lock_guard<Mutex> locked(Mutex &);*/
> >
> >   locked(my_mutex) {
> >   }
>
> This reminds me Python's with statement.  In C++, it may
> look like:
>
>   with (expr) {
>

The 'using' keyword would be unambiguous here.


>     // ...
>   }
>
>   If you need a name,
>
>   with (auto name = expr) {
>   }
>

Would this be exactly identical to

{
  auto name = expr;
  // ...
}

?


> And I can further imagine that this requires a
> _compound-statement_, so that we can have
>
>   struct A {
>     A() with (expr) {
>     }
>   };
